Planning Your Visit

Timing Your Visit

While the Main Colonnade is beautiful year-round, consider visiting during off-peak hours to fully appreciate its architecture and peaceful atmosphere. Weekday mornings or late afternoons often offer a more serene experience, allowing you to savor the details without large crowds.

Spring Water Experience

The colonnade is famous for its mineral springs, each with unique properties. Bring a cup or purchase one onsite to sample the different waters. Remember, some are rich in iron, so be prepared for a distinct taste!

Frequently Asked Questions

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

The Main Colonnade is centrally located in Marienbad (Marianske Lazne). It's easily accessible on foot if you're staying in the town center. Public transport options like buses also serve the area, with stops typically a short walk away. Parking can be challenging in the immediate vicinity, so consider public transport or walking if possible.

Parking near the Main Colonnade can be limited and may involve paid parking zones. It's advisable to check local parking regulations or opt for public transport to avoid any hassle.

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ry

Entry to the Main Colonnade itself is generally free. You can walk through and admire the architecture without purchasing a ticket. However, if there are specific events or exhibitions within the colonnade, separate admission fees might apply.

The Main Colonnade is typically accessible throughout the day, allowing visitors to stroll through its halls at their leisure. Specific areas or any associated facilities might have their own operating hours, so it's best to check locally if you plan to visit any particular shops or cafes within.

Yes, you can! The colonnade is famous for its mineral springs. You'll need to bring your own cup or purchase one onsite to sample the different waters, each with unique mineral content.

The Architectural Charm

The Main Colonnade Maxim Gorky is celebrated for its distinctive architecture, often described as having a feminine-like quality in its form and accents. This unique style sets it apart and makes it an iconic symbol of Marienbad. Visitors frequently comment on its beauty and how it embodies the character of the town. While generally well-maintained, some reviews suggest that certain elements, like the flooring, could benefit from reconstruction to enhance the overall aesthetic and durability.Reddit

This colonnade is more than just a structure; it's a testament to the spa town's historical elegance. Its design invites visitors to slow down, observe the details, and appreciate the craftsmanship. The interplay of light and shadow within its arches creates a dynamic visual experience throughout the day, making it a photographer's delight.Instagram

The Healing Waters

A primary draw of the Main Colonnade is its array of mineral springs. Each spring offers a unique taste and therapeutic properties, with some being particularly rich in iron.Reddit Visitors are encouraged to bring a cup or purchase one onsite to sample these distinct waters. This ritual of tasting the springs is an integral part of the spa town experience, offering a chance to connect with the natural healing elements that define Marienbad.

While the experience of tasting the waters is highly recommended, it's worth noting that the taste can be quite specific, especially for those rich in iron. It's a unique sensory experience that many find both intriguing and beneficial. The colonnade provides a beautiful setting for this age-old practice, making it a memorable part of any visit.
